Target USA — Episode 155: The impact of the US withdrawal from the INF Treaty

On Feb. 1, Secretary of State Mike Pompeo announced the U.S. was going to withdraw from the historic Intermediate-Range Nuclear Forces Treaty (INF), negotiated in 1987 by former U.S. President Ronald Reagan and Soviet leader Mikhail Gorbachev. This came after years of discussions, technical meetings and intelligence sharing by U.S. officials to show the Putin…
